What Does a Car Locksmith Do?
A car locksmith specializes in automotive security. They are trained to handle a large range of problems associated with locks, keys, and security systems in cars. Here are some of the main services they use:
Key Replacement and Duplication
- Lost or Stolen Keys: If a car owner loses their keys, a locksmith can produce a new set using the vehicle's unique key code or by translating the lock.
- Duplicate Keys: Creating an extra set of keys for convenience or for relative.
Key Extraction
- Broken Keys: Sometimes keys break off inside the lock. A car locksmith has the knowledge to safely extract the broken key without damaging the lock.
Lock Repair and Replacement
- Harmed Locks: If a car lock is damaged due to wear and tear or an attempted break-in, a locksmith can repair or replace it.
- Rekeying: Changing the internal pins of a lock to make it work with a new set of keys, making sure the old keys no longer work.
High-Security Key Services
- Transponder Keys: Modern vehicles often utilize transponder keys, which have a chip that communicates with the car's security system. Car locksmith professionals can program and replace these keys.
- Remote Car Keys: Repairing or replacing remote car keys, consisting of those with integrated keyless entry systems.
Car Lockout Assistance
- Emergency situation Lockout: If you lock yourself out of your car, a locksmith can quickly and safely unlock the vehicle.
- Trunk Lockout: Assistance with unlocking the trunk if you inadvertently lock your keys within.
Ignition Repair and Replacement
- Run-down Ignitions: Over time, the ignition switch can wear, making it difficult to start the car. A locksmith can repair or replace the ignition switch.
Keyless Entry Systems
- Installation and Programming: Installing and programming keyless entry systems for added convenience and security.
Vehicle Security Consultation
- Security Assessments: Providing guidance on improving the security of your vehicle, consisting of suggestions for extra locks or alarms.
Tools of the Trade
Car locksmiths use a variety of specialized tools to perform their tasks effectively and successfully. Here are a few of the essential tools in their arsenal:
- Key Cutting Machines: These makers can duplicate keys rapidly and precisely.
- Lock Decoder: A gadget used to figure out the key code for a lock.
- Lock Picking Tools: For emergency situation lockouts, locksmiths use these tools to open locks without triggering damage.
- Transponder Key Programmer: This device is used to program transponder keys to work with a car's security system.
- Laser Key Cutting Machine: For high-precision key cutting, particularly for intricate key styles.
- Ignition Cylinder Puller: A tool used to get rid of the ignition cylinder for repair or replacement.
- Pin Extractors: Used to get rid of broken pins from locks throughout repairs.

FAQs About Car Locksmiths
Q: How do I find a credible car locksmith?
- A: Look for locksmith professionals with certifications from professional companies such as the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A). Read online evaluations and request for recommendations from friends or household. Constantly examine for a license and insurance before working with a locksmith.
Q: Can a car locksmith open my car without harming it?
- A: Yes, professional car locksmith professionals use specialized tools and methods to open locks without causing damage. They are trained to manage a variety of lock types and can typically access to your vehicle quickly and securely.
Q: How long does it take to have a new key made?
- A: The time it takes to make a new key depends on the type of key and the intricacy of the lock. Simple key duplications can take simply a few minutes, while transponder key programming may take longer, often 30 minutes to an hour.
Q: Is it legal to have a locksmith make a key for my car?
- A: Yes, it is legal as long as you can prove ownership of the vehicle. A lot of locksmiths will need recognition and a valid reason for requiring a new key.
Q: Can car locksmith professionals program contemporary keyless entry systems?
- A: Yes, lots of car locksmiths are geared up to program and set up keyless entry systems. They have the necessary tools and understanding to guarantee that your brand-new system works seamlessly with your vehicle.
Q: What should I do if I lose my car keys?
- A: Contact an expert car locksmith immediately. They can offer a safe and effective solution to get you back into your car and produce a brand-new set of keys if required.
The Future of Car Locksmithing
As technology advances, the function of the car locksmith is developing. Modern automobiles are progressively equipped with sophisticated security systems, consisting of keyless entry and clever key technology. Car locksmith professionals are constantly updating their skills and obtaining new tools to stay up to date with these advancements. Here are some patterns to view:
- Increased Use of Smart Technology: More cars and trucks are including integrated wise systems that can be accessed through smart devices or other devices.
- Biometric Locks: Some luxury automobiles are explore biometric locks, such as finger print or facial acknowledgment, which will require specific knowledge from locksmith professionals.
- Remote Services: With the rise of mobile technology, car locksmith professionals are using more remote services, such as key programming via smart device apps.
